New enhanced bus service on line 25 Angus

Montréal, August 20, 2019 – The Société de transport de Montréal (STM) wishes to inform its customers of a new enhanced bus service on line 25 Angus, starting August 26, 2019.

“The improved service will operate during peak periods Monday to Friday, from 7:00 to 9:00 a.m. and from 4:00 to 6:00 p.m., guaranteeing a ten-minute frequency in both directions. This will allow us to provide better service to our customers using the line,” said Philippe Schnobb, Chairman of the Board of Directors of the STM.

“The purpose of these measures is to facilitate access to a major employment hub using public transportation. By implementing them, the STM aims to create a modal shift in favour of sustainable transportation and new travel habits for citizens living in or coming to the area,” said Eric-Alan Caldwell, City of Montréal executive committee member responsible for transportation.

This service improvement is in addition to the improvements that were implemented last June outside of peak periods and in the evenings and last January during peak morning and afternoon periods. Line 25 Angus was introduced in 2006 and specifically aims to provide access to public transit for Technopôle Angus workers and residents in the Mercier–Hochelaga-Maisonneuve and Rosemont–La-Petite-Patrie areas.
